SINGARI MEM: A Comprehensive Overview of an Upper Primary School in Assam

SINGARI MEM, a government-run upper primary school, stands as a vital educational institution serving the rural community of JURIA block in NAGAON district, Assam. Established in 1948, the school operates under the Department of Education, reflecting a commitment to providing quality education to its students. Its location in a rural setting underscores its critical role in bridging educational gaps in underserved areas.

The school's infrastructure comprises a government building equipped with three classrooms, all maintained in good condition. Beyond the classrooms, the school also features additional rooms for non-teaching activities and a dedicated space for the headmaster and teachers. While lacking a boundary wall, the school boasts essential amenities like electricity and a functional playground, crucial elements for a holistic learning environment.

SINGARI MEM offers upper primary education (classes 6-8), catering specifically to students within this age group. It functions as a co-educational institution, welcoming both boys and girls, with a balanced staff of five male and five female teachers, headed by MAJIBUR RAHMAN. The total teacher count of ten ensures a conducive student-teacher ratio, enabling effective instruction and personalized attention.

Instruction at SINGARI MEM is conducted in Assamese, reflecting a commitment to imparting education in the local language. The school operates on an academic calendar that commences in April, aligning with the broader educational framework in the region. The school's commitment to providing meals, prepared on the premises, ensures students receive adequate nutrition, supporting their physical well-being and academic performance.

The school's resources include a functional library containing 25 books, serving as a valuable asset for students to enhance their knowledge beyond the classroom. The provision of hand pumps provides a reliable source of drinking water, addressing a fundamental need for hygiene and well-being. Furthermore, ramps for disabled children are in place, ensuring accessibility for all students, reflecting the school's inclusivity.
